ANN ARBOR, MICHIGAN, UNITED STATES March 7, 2025
A major Tier 1 automotive supplier has achieved a 60% reduction in 3D printing times as an early adopter of the Ulendo VC (Vibration Compensation) software upgrade for the CreatBot F430 extrusion-based printer. The company printed 9 prototype seating brackets on a single build plate. This build would have normally taken 14 hours and 30 minutes at stock settings but, with the Ulendo VC software upgrade, the print job was completed in 6 hours and 15 minutes without sacrificing build quality. The print was performed at a speed of 150mm/sec with acceleration of 3,000/sec2, a 3X and 5X improvement over stock settings, respectively.
The supplier, who remains anonymous due to the nature of their R&D work, routinely uses extrusion-based 3D printing in its design and prototyping process for seating and electrical components.

“Many of the prototype parts this client builds are quite large and can take 14 to 24 hours to produce. This makes it difficult to fit into working schedules and can lead to longer than ideal development timelines,” says Brenda Jones, Ulendo’s CEO. “Quick turnaround and rapid iteration are essential for their operations.”
Ulendo VC is a unique software solution that enables faster print speeds without any loss in quality by canceling out vibration in FDM printers. Vibration has long plagued FDM printers, limiting speed and build quality. Furthermore, vibration-driven quality issues such as “ghosting,” “ringing” and “layer shifting” are amplified on large industrial FDM printers, significantly limiting their performance. While previously available solutions such as “input shaping” may be sufficient for hobbyist desktop printers, they cannot solve the challenges faced by professional users operating industrial FDM printers at high speed. Ulendo VC solves this challenge through a unique, patented software algorithm that counteracts vibration in real time, leading to significantly higher speeds and high-quality results on every build.
“By taking a 14:30 build and knocking it down to 6:15, the client is now able to do their build prep and get the part out on the same day,” added Jones. “It really transforms how they are able to use additive in their R&D process.”
Ulendo has partnered with Rev1 Technologies, the exclusive after-sales support provider for CreatBot printers in the U.S., to develop and distribute the software upgrade for the F430 model. In initial tests, Ulendo VC has been able to generate a 5X improvement in speed and acceleration on the F430, reaching speeds of 250mm/sec and acceleration of 3,000mm/sec2 without any ringing, ghosting, or corner rounding.
“As a software only solution, Ulendo VC is incredibly easy for our customers to adopt,” says Ben Hartwig, President of Rev1 Technologies. “For customers in contract manufacturing or using additive in production, this dramatically improves the efficiency and overall profitability of their additive operations.”
Rev1 and Ulendo are currently working on software upgrades for even larger format CreatBot machines. ABOUT ULENDO TECHNOLOGIES, INC.
Ulendo Technologies is a software company focused on solving the challenges facing adoption and scale of advanced manufacturing (AM) processes, making AM machines faster, higher quality, and more repeatable. Founded in 2018 by Chinedum ‘Chi’ Okwudire, Associate Professor of Mechanical Engineering at the University of Michigan, the company is composed of engineering, software development, and advanced manufacturing experts dedicated to making cutting-edge solutions practical for our clients.
The company’s first products improved the speed and quality of extrusion-based 3D printers: Ulendo VC (Vibration Compensation), an advanced set of algorithms that doubles printing speed without degrading the quality and Ulendo Calibration-as-a-ServiceTM, a cloud-based auto calibration tool.
With the introduction of Ulendo HC (heat compensation), the company has expanded into the growing metal 3D printing market. The company’s overall goal is to deliver a collection of revolutionary software products to the advanced manufacturing industry (i.e., 3D printers, industrial robots). ABOUT REV1 TECHNOLOGIES
Rev1 Technologies, founded in 2017 as Delscan and rebranded in 2022, is a U.S.-based company specializing in industrial 3D scanning and printing solutions for engineers and manufacturers. As a gold-certified partner of Artec 3D and a provider of metrology-grade 3D scanners, Rev1 also offers a diverse range of 3D printers, including CreatBot’s large-format FDM printers. Recognized for its exceptional service, Rev1 has been appointed as the exclusive after-sales support provider for CreatBot across the U.S., ensuring customers receive top-tier service and expert assistance throughout the life of their machines. Rev1 is also the first U.S. partner for Heygears Reflex, which offers industrial desktop resin printers, and provides AI vision inspection solutions for inline production defect detection, helping clients reduce errors and optimize efficiency.
